EU Relations with China, Japan and North Korea
Trends, Issues and Implications for the EU Role in Asian Security
This paper provides an analysis of the EU's political, economic and security relations with Japan, China and North Korea. At the same time, the author outlines the Union's overall role and engagement in Asian security. He touches on issues such as the lack of inner European policy coordination, human rights violations, trade and investment, institutional cooperation as well as humanitarian aid. The author concludes that the extent of European cooperation with these Asian states depends heavily on the political system of the respective nation and the EU’s perception thereof.
